📜  cpp 中的 hello world - C++ (1)

📅  最后修改于: 2023-12-03 15:00:03.034000             🧑  作者: Mango

C++中的Hello World

简介

"Hello, World!"是最简单的计算机程序,它的主要目的是向新手程序员展示一些语言的最小特性。在本文中,我们将为您介绍如何使用C++写Hello World程序。

步骤
步骤1:创建一个新的C++文件

首先,我们需要在计算机上创建一个新的C++文件。使用文本编译器例如Visual Studio Code,VS等, 或使用集成开发环境(IDE)例如Visual Studio、CodeBlocks,等可以提供代码补全和调试工具,可以加快编写和测试程序的速度。

步骤2:编写代码

然后,我们需要编写C++代码,输出“Hello, World!”到控制台。 c++ 中的控制台输出是使用标准输出(cout)语句完成的。Code如下:

#include <iostream>

int main()
{
  std::cout << "Hello, World!";
  return 0;
}

在实现上看起来很短,但如果您是刚刚开始学习C++,这段代码可能会很困难。下面是解释:

  1. #include <iostream>:这行代码是将C++的输入输出流(head file:iostream)包含到您的程序中。包含iostream头文件是C++中进行输入输出操作的基础。
  2. using namespace std;:如果我们想要使用std::cout语句,我们需要将命名空间std包含到我们的代码之中,又或者使用此语句简化在std namespace 中调用时的写法。所以,这一行代码包含了std标准命名空间。
  3. int main():这是我们程序的主函数,程序从这一行开始运行。在本例中,我们的程序只有一个函数,所以主函数是唯一的函数。函数的返回值是一个整数(int),它指示系统程序退出状态,0表示成功。
  4. std::cout << "Hello, World!";:这一行代码输出“Hello, World!”到控制台,这是程序的主要目标。
步骤3:编译代码

现在,我们将使用C++编译器编译文件中的代码以生成可执行文件。如果是IDE打开的文件,直接使用IDE的菜单中的编译选项即可;如果使用命令行编译,请确保已经在计算机上安装了C++编译器如GCC等。使用此命令行来编译以上代码:

g++ -o HelloWorld.exe HelloWorld.cpp

其中,g++是C++编译器,-o表示生成可执行文件,HelloWorld.exe是可执行文件的名称,HelloWorld.cpp是包含我们代码的文件名。

步骤4:执行可执行文件

编译完成后,我们就可以执行可执行文件来验证我们的程序是否输出“Hello, World!”到控制台。在命令行上运行以下命令来运行可执行文件:

./HelloWorld.exe

如果一切正常,您将在控制台上看到“Hello, World!”的输出。

结论

我们介绍了如何在C++中编写Hello World程序。如果您刚刚开始学习C++,这可能是一个很好的起点!